2012-08-24 2 views
10

Windows 7 (64 비트)에서 VS2010을 사용하고 있습니다. VS의 "Extension Manager"에서 "Nuget Package Manager"를 설치하려고하면 실패합니다. 다운로드가 작동하지만 설치 진행률 막대에 멈추었습니다. Windows 작업 관리자를 보면 설치 프로그램이 "vsixinstaller.exe"프로세스의 새 인스턴스를 계속 시작한다는 것을 알 수 있습니다. 컴퓨터가 궁극적으로 충돌 할 때까지 계속 켜집니다.Nuget Package Manager를 설치할 수 없습니다.

"NuGet.Tools.vsix"파일을 직접 시작할 때와 동일한 문제가 발생합니다.

그물을 검색했지만 유용한 것을 찾을 수 없었습니다.

+0

이것도 여기에보고되었습니다 : http://nuget.codeplex.com/workitem/2327 –

+0

이 단계들을 시도해주세요. VS 의 닫기 모든 인스턴스는 HKEY_CURRENT_USER \ 소프트웨어 \ 마이크로 소프트 \으로 VisualStudio \의 내용을 검사 11.0 \ ExtensionManager \의 PendingDeletions 각 항목에 나와있는 폴더를 삭제 HKEY_CURRENT_USER \ 소프트웨어 \ 마이크로 소프트 \으로 VisualStudio를 삭제 \ 11.0 \ ExtensionManager \의 PendingDeletions –

+1

제프 , 당신의 제안에 감사드립니다. Visual Studio를 다시 설치하고 최신 SP를 적용한 후에 문제가 해결되었습니다. –

답변

3

오늘도 동일한 동작이 발생 했으므로 조사를 위해 프로세스 모니터를 열기로 결정했습니다.

추측 ... 프로세스 모니터는 동일한 동작을 제공합니다. 그런 다음 전구가 꺼졌습니다. :)

응답 : 이전에는 노트북에 관리자 권한이 있었지만 새해 초에 제거되었습니다. 어떤 이유로 이러한 프로그램이 관리자 그룹에없는 자격 증명을 사용하면 실패, 시간 초과 또는 액세스 거부보고 대신 재귀 적으로 자신을 호출합니다.

다음과 같이 VS를 시작한 후에 업데이트를 시도해야합니다. 관리자.

나는이 피드백을 nuget support thread에도 제공 할 예정입니다.

0

NuGet 문서 Known Issues에서 해결책을 찾았습니다. SP1이 있더라도 권장하는 핫픽스를 설치하십시오. KB2581019가 포함되어 있습니다.

1

관리자 권한으로 Nuget을 SP1에 설치하여 수정되었습니다.